Chromium(III) potassium sulfate dodecahydrate (CAS: 7788-99-0) is a hydrated chromium compound with the chemical formula KCr(SO4)2·12H2O. It appears as a pink crystalline solid and is highly soluble in water. This compound is commonly used in chemical research and industrial applications due to its stability and reactivity in aqueous solutions.
Chromium(III) potassium sulfate dodecahydrate (CAS: 7788-99-0) is used in pharmaceuticals as a reagent for drug synthesis, in industrial processes for water treatment and dyeing, and in research for analytical chemistry. It also serves as a source of chromium ions in chemical reactions and is employed in the production of other chromium compounds.
Chromium(III) potassium sulfate dodecahydrate (CAS: 7788-99-0) is considered less toxic than Chromium(VI) compounds, but safety precautions are still necessary. Direct contact may cause skin or eye irritation, so protective gloves, goggles, and ventilation are recommended. Follow OSHA and EPA guidelines for handling and disposal to ensure workplace and environmental safety.
Chromium(III) potassium sulfate dodecahydrate (CAS: 7788-99-0) should be stored in a cool, dry, and dark place in airtight, moisture-proof containers. Maintain storage conditions below 25°C and away from incompatible materials to preserve stability. Ensure proper labeling and avoid exposure to high humidity or direct sunlight to prevent degradation.
